数据库中除是什么意思

fiy 其他 2

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,"除"是一种用于执行除法操作的算术运算符。它用于将一个数值除以另一个数值,并返回商作为结果。除法操作通常用于数学计算和数据分析中。

    以下是关于数据库中"除"的一些重要信息:

    1. 语法:在大多数数据库系统中,除法操作使用斜杠(/)符号表示。例如,可以使用以下语法执行除法操作:SELECT column1 / column2 FROM table;

    2. 数据类型:在执行除法操作时,数据库系统会自动进行类型转换。它将确保被除数和除数具有兼容的数据类型,以便执行除法操作。通常,数据库系统支持数字类型(如整数、浮点数等)进行除法操作。

    3. 零除错误:在进行除法操作时,需要注意被除数不能为零。如果除数为零,将导致零除错误。大多数数据库系统会检测到这种错误并抛出异常,以避免计算错误。

    4. 结果精度:除法操作的结果可能会受到数据类型和精度的影响。例如,如果被除数和除数都是整数类型,那么结果将是整数类型,可能会导致精度损失。为了获得更准确的结果,可以使用浮点数类型进行除法操作。

    5. NULL 值处理:在数据库中,除法操作也适用于包含 NULL 值的列。如果被除数或除数为 NULL,那么结果也将为 NULL。因此,在进行除法操作时,需要注意处理 NULL 值的情况,以避免不确定的结果。

    总之,数据库中的"除"是一种用于执行除法操作的算术运算符。它具有特定的语法和数据类型要求,并且需要注意零除错误和处理 NULL 值的情况。了解这些信息可以帮助我们在数据库中正确地使用除法操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,除是一种用于数据查询和筛选的操作符。它的作用是从一个数据集中排除满足特定条件的数据行。除操作符可以结合其他条件操作符使用,如等于、大于、小于等,用于更精确地筛选所需的数据。

    除操作符的语法通常为:NOT,例如:NOT condition,其中condition是一个布尔表达式,用于描述需要排除的数据行的条件。如果condition为真,则该行将被排除在结果集之外。

    除操作符可以用于各种查询语句中,例如SELECT、UPDATE、DELETE等。在SELECT语句中,除操作符可以用于WHERE子句中,用于排除不满足特定条件的数据行。在UPDATE和DELETE语句中,除操作符可以用于WHERE子句中,用于排除不需要更新或删除的数据行。

    除操作符的使用可以使数据库查询更加灵活和精确。它可以帮助我们排除不需要的数据,从而提高查询效率和准确性。除操作符可以与其他条件操作符结合使用,构建复杂的查询条件,以满足不同的查询需求。

    总之,除操作符是数据库中一种用于排除满足特定条件的数据行的操作符。它可以帮助我们进行数据的筛选和查询,提高查询效率和准确性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,"除"是一种数学运算符,表示除法操作。除法是指将一个数(被除数)分成若干个相等的部分(除数),每一部分的大小叫做商。数据库中的除法操作可以用来从一个表中筛选出符合某个条件的数据,并将这些数据作为结果返回。

    在数据库中,除法操作通常与其他操作符(例如选择、投影、连接等)结合使用,以实现复杂的查询。下面是一些常用的除法操作的方法和操作流程。

    1. 使用除法操作符
      数据库中常用的除法操作符是"/",用于执行除法运算。可以将其用于查询语句的SELECT子句中,将被除数和除数放在该操作符的左右两侧。例如:
    SELECT column1 / column2 AS result
    FROM table
    WHERE condition;
    

    其中,column1是被除数,column2是除数,result是商。table是要查询的表,condition是查询的条件。

    1. 使用子查询
      除法操作也可以使用子查询来实现。首先,可以编写一个子查询,用于返回除数的结果集。然后,在主查询中使用该子查询作为条件,筛选出符合条件的被除数,从而得到商。
    SELECT column1
    FROM table1
    WHERE column2 IN (SELECT column3 FROM table2 WHERE condition);
    

    在上述示例中,column1是被除数,table1是要查询的表,column2是连接两个表的条件,column3是除数所在的列,table2是包含除数的表,condition是查询的条件。

    1. 使用连接操作
      除法操作也可以通过连接操作来实现。可以将两个表连接起来,并在连接条件中使用除法操作符,从而得到商。
    SELECT column1
    FROM table1
    JOIN table2 ON column1 / column2 = column3
    WHERE condition;
    

    在上述示例中,column1是被除数,table1是要查询的表,column2是除数所在的列,column3是连接条件中的商,table2是包含除数的表,condition是查询的条件。

    总结:
    在数据库中,除法操作是一种用于筛选符合某个条件的数据的方法。可以使用除法操作符、子查询或连接操作来实现除法操作。通过合理地使用这些方法,可以实现复杂的查询,并从数据库中获取所需的数据。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部